Skechers U.S.A. (NYSE:SKX) PT Lowered to $80.00

Skechers U.S.A. (NYSE:SKXGet Free Report) had its target price lowered by investment analysts at Bank of America from $81.00 to $80.00 in a note issued to investors on Friday, Benzinga reports. The firm presently has a “buy” rating on the textile maker’s stock. Bank of America‘s target price would suggest a potential upside of 35.11% from the stock’s previous close.

Skechers U.S.A. Stock Performance

NYSE:SKX opened at $59.21 on Friday. The company has a market capitalization of $9.03 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 15.58, a PEG ratio of 0.89 and a beta of 1.22. The business has a 50 day moving average of $65.98 and a 200 day moving average of $66.11.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.01, a current ratio of 2.06 and a quick ratio of 1.33. Skechers U.S.A. has a 1-year low of $45.58 and a 1-year high of $75.09.

Skechers U.S.A. (NYSE:SKXG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, October 24th. The textile maker reported $1.26 E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.15 by $0.11. Skechers U.S.A. had a net margin of 6.90% and a return on equity of 13.04%. The firm had revenue of $2.35 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$2.31 billion. During the same period last year, the firm posted $0.93 earnings per share. The business’s revenue was up 16.0% compared to the same quarter last year. On average, sell-side analysts predict that Skechers U.S.A. will post 4.15 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Skechers U.S.A. declared that its Board of Directors has initiated a stock repurchase program on Thursday, July 25th that permits the company to repurchase $1.00 billion in outstanding shares. This repurchase authorization permits the textile maker to reacquire up to 10.3%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ock repurchase programs are usually an indication that the company’s board believes its stock is undervalued.

Skechers U.S.A. Company Profile

Skechers U.SA, Inc designs, develops, markets, and distributes footwear for men, women, and children worldwide. The company operates through Wholesale and Direct-to-Consumer segments. It offers footwear under Skechers Hands Free Slip-ins, Skechers Arch Fit, and Skechers Air-Cooled Memory Foam brands.
